A Guide to Non-Invasive Dent Repair
Paintless Dent Repair, or PDR, is an advanced technique designed to repair minor dents and dings from the body of a vehicle without compromising its original paint finish. This technique involves using specific instruments to carefully manipulate the affected metal back into its original shape. The instruments are crafted to access the backside of the panel, enabling accurate restoration that leaves the paint intact.
This approach is perfect for small to mid-sized dings, specifically those created by hail damage, ball impacts, or light bumps.
When comparing costs, Paintless Dent Repair usually emerges the more economical choice in comparison with conventional dent repair techniques. Conventional repair methods generally need surface preparation, body fillers, and new paint, which not only costs more in labor but may compromise the original paintwork.
In contrast, PDR keeps the original paint and calls for substantially less material and time. This results in a smaller overall cost and often a faster turnaround. By selecting PDR, you're selecting a repair technique that eliminates potential reductions in your vehicle's resale value because of mismatched paint or visible filler materials.
Benefits of Opting for Paintless Repair Techniques
You've discovered how paintless dent repair (PDR) helps save your hard-earned money versus traditional methods, but the benefits don't end there. This approach isn't just cost-effective but also offers significant environmental benefits, making it an excellent choice for eco-conscious car owners like yourself.
To begin with, PDR doesn't require chemicals, fillers, or paint normally needed in traditional body repairs. This elimination of toxic materials guarantees there's no risk of harmful emissions, protecting air quality and decreasing your vehicle's environmental footprint. By avoiding the need for paint, PDR avoids volatile organic compounds (VOCs) that standard painting methods emit, which are detrimental to both environmental and human health.
Furthermore, the high efficiency of PDR concerning both time and resources means lower energy consumption. Traditional body shop methods commonly include time-consuming sanding, painting, and drying processes that don't just check here use up considerable energy but also lengthen your vehicle's time off the road.
Conversely, PDR can be completed significantly faster, which enhances its cost efficiency by reducing your time off the road and reducing labor costs.
Opting for paintless dent repair isn't just a cost-effective choice—it's a step towards environmentally conscious vehicle maintenance.
What Types of Damage Can We Fix?
Car enthusiasts commonly ask about the types of damage PDR technicians can successfully repair. It's worth noting that this approach is highly effective for addressing small to medium-sized dents, especially in cases where the paint surface remains intact.
PDR works best for fixing shallow dents that commonly happen because of common occurrences including shopping carts hitting your car or flying debris. This approach is particularly effective for addressing crease damage, which are usually more difficult because of the metal deformation.
Moreover, PDR stands as the ideal solution for restoring hail damage, which often leaves numerous dents across your vehicle's exterior. Given that these dents usually don't affect the paint layer, they will be effectively repaired using PDR, preserving your car's original finish.
You'll find PDR extremely useful for repairing parking lot damage, which commonly happen in parking lots. In contrast to traditional techniques that may need sanding, filler, or repainting, PDR works by carefully reshaping the damaged area back to its initial state, ensuring no trace of the damage remains.
For cases involving shallow dents in which the paint remains undamaged, PDR can effectively return your car's look without the complications of traditional restoration approaches.

Will Paintless Dent Repair Affect Your Car's Resale Value?
No, paintless dent repair won't affect your car's resale value.
In fact, this technique generally preserves the vehicle by maintaining the initial paint and body integrity. This approach removes dents without calling for repainting or filler, which can be clear evidence of previous damage to potential buyers.
It's an excellent choice if you're interested in preserving your car in excellent condition for future sale, as it keeps the exterior looking original and unblemished.
